Functions/Install-OSServerPreReqs.ps1
function Install-OSServerPreReqs { <# .SYNOPSIS Installs the pre-requisites for the OutSystems platform server. .DESCRIPTION This will install the pre-requisites for the OutSystems platform server. You should run first the Test-OSServerSoftwareReqs and the Test-OSServerHardwareReqs cmdlets to check if the server is supported for OutSystems. .PARAMETER MajorVersion Specifies the platform major version. Accepted values: 10 or 11. .PARAMETER InstallIISMgmtConsole Specifies if the IIS Managament Console will be installed. On servers without GUI this feature can't be installed so you should set this parameter to $false. .PARAMETER SourcePath Specifies a local path having the pre-requisites binaries. .EXAMPLE Install-OSServerPreReqs -MajorVersion "10" .EXAMPLE Install-OSServerPreReqs -MajorVersion "11" -InstallIISMgmtConsole:$false .EXAMPLE Install-OSServerPreReqs -MajorVersion "11" -InstallIISMgmtConsole:$false -SourcePath "c:\downloads" #> [CmdletBinding()] [OutputType('Outsystems.SetupTools.InstallResult')] param( [Parameter(Mandatory = $true)] [ValidatePattern('1[0-1]{1}(\.0)?')] [string]$MajorVersion, [Parameter()] [Alias('Sources')] [ValidateNotNullOrEmpty()] [string]$SourcePath, [Parameter()] [bool]$InstallIISMgmtConsole = $true ) begin { LogMessage -Function $($MyInvocation.Mycommand) -Phase 0 -Stream 0 -Message "Starting" SendFunctionStartEvent -InvocationInfo $MyInvocation # Initialize the results object $installResult = [pscustomobject]@{ PSTypeName = 'Outsystems.SetupTools.InstallResult' Success = $true RebootNeeded = $false ExitCode = 0 Message = 'OutSystems platform server pre-requisites successfully installed' } #The MajorVersion parameter supports 11.0 or 11.
